James Fenton - Awards and Honours

Awards and Honours

  • 1968 Newdigate Prize
  • 1971 Eric Gregory Award
  • 1981 Southern Arts Literature Award for Poetry
  • 1983 Fellowship of The Royal Society of Literature
  • 1984 Geoffrey Faber Memorial Prize
  • 1994 Oxford Professor of Poetry
  • 1994 Whitbread Prize for Poetry, for Out of Danger
  • 1999 Honorary Fellowship of Magdalen College
  • 2003 Fellowship of The Royal Society of Arts
  • 2007 Queen's Gold Medal for Poetry

    Vain men delight in telling what Honours have been done them, what great Company they have kept, and the like; by which they plainly confess, that these Honours were more than their Due, and such as their Friends would not believe if they had not been told: Whereas a Man truly proud, thinks the greatest Honours below his Merit, and consequently scorns to boast. I therefore deliver it as a Maxim that whoever desires the Character of a proud Man, ought to conceal his Vanity.
    Jonathan Swift (1667–1745)
